The Forêt de Saoû

A forest massifto discover
Just 30 minutes from Gervanne Camping, Forêt de Saoû is one of the most emblematic natural sites in the Drôme valley.
Classified as a Sensitive Natural Area, this remarkable forest offers a spectacular backdrop of limestone cliffs, deep beech forests, luminous clearings and grandiose panoramas.

The perched syncline: a landscape unique in Europe
The Forêt de Saoû is famous for its perched syncline, a rare geological formation.
In concrete terms, this is a valley entirely surrounded by cliffs, formed by the folding of rocks millions of years ago.
This spectacular relief gives rise to an enclosed, almost secretive landscape, dominated by the crests of the Trois Becs, visible from many points in the valley.
On a hike, it’s easy to see why this site has always fascinated geologists, naturalists and walkers.
Tours for all levels
The Forêt de Saoû is a hiker’s paradise.
Numerous marked trails allow you to discover the forest at your own pace:
- Easy, family-friendly walks deep in the forest, in the shade of the trees
- Intermediate hikes to belvederes and viewpoints
- Sporty itineraries leading to the crests and the Trois Becs, with spectacular panoramic views of the Vercors and the Drôme valley
The forest reveals all its richness: orchids, majestic beech trees, birds of prey, chamois…

Climbing and outdoor activities
The cliffs surrounding the forest also make Saoû a renowned climbing site, with routes adapted to different levels.
It’s an ideal playground for vertical enthusiasts, in an exceptional natural setting.
The forest is also ideal for wildlife observation, nature photography and educational outings, always with respect for this protected site.
L’Auberge des Dauphins: culture and gourmet delights
In the heart of the forest lies Auberge des Dauphins, a place steeped in history.
Formerly a coaching inn, today it is home to :
- a restaurant appreciated for its simple, seasonal cuisine,
- an exhibition section, highlighting the site’s history, geology and biodiversity.
It’s an ideal place to stop off after a hike, for a bite to eat or to deepen your understanding of the forest and the perched syncline.

The Forêt de Saoû is a fragile natural area.
To preserve it, a few simple rules apply:
– stay on the marked trails,
– don’t pick plants,
– respect the fauna and the calm of the area,
– keep dogs on a leash according to regulations.
Discovering Saoû also means learning to walk gently, observe and listen.
